The final resting place of Matteo Ricci, and other foreign missionaries to China - central square of the Beijing Administrative College 北京行政学院国际交流合作部
Matteo Ricci, an Italian missionary, came to China in 1582. Besides preaching, he also introduced Western sciences of Astronomy, the Calendar, geography and mathematics to Chinese people. He was buried here (current day Beijing Administrative College) in 1611 after his death. The place later became the cemetery of foreign missionaries in Beijing. Now 63 tombstones exist here. It was named one of the National Important Cultural Relic Protection Sites in 2006.
